South Korea Fiber Optics Collimating Lens Market Overview & Growth Outlook
The South Korea fiber optics collimating lens market is projected to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of approximately 8.5% from 2023 to 2032, reaching an estimated valuation of USD 250 million by 2032. This growth is driven by the expanding adoption of fiber optic communication systems across various sectors, including telecommunications, data centers, and industrial automation. The market’s increasing sophistication reflects South Korea’s commitment to maintaining its leadership in optical technology innovation.

Key Growth Drivers in the South Korea Fiber Optics Collimating Lens Market
South Korea’s fiber optics collimating lens market is experiencing rapid growth driven by several converging factors. The country’s technological leadership, government support, and evolving industry demands create a fertile environment for market expansion.
- Industrial Demand Expansion: The surge in fiber optic deployment across telecommunications, data centers, and industrial automation fuels the need for high-precision collimating lenses. As industries upgrade to faster, more reliable connectivity, optical component quality and performance become critical.
- Technology Adoption: South Korea’s early adoption of 5G and IoT technologies accelerates the demand for advanced optical solutions. Innovations in miniaturization and integration are pushing manufacturers to develop more sophisticated collimating lenses.
- Government Policies & Support: Strategic initiatives such as the “Digital New Deal” and R&D funding programs bolster the optical industry’s growth. Policies aimed at fostering innovation and infrastructure expansion directly benefit the fiber optics sector.
- Infrastructure Development: Ongoing investments in nationwide 5G networks and smart city projects require high-quality optical components, including collimating lenses, to ensure seamless connectivity and data transmission.
